记录一个redis类型冲突报错:

摘要: org.springframework.daoInvalidDataAccessApiUsageException: WRONGTYPE Operation against a key holding the wrong kind of value; nested exception is redi 阅读全文
posted @ 2020-07-01 22:22 哈皮的玩偶 阅读(589) 评论(0) 推荐(0) 编辑

jdk动态代理 和 cglib动态代理

摘要: //结果 enhancing eat jdk动态代理:jdk自带,被代理类实现接口,委托类(handler)实现InvocationHandler,方法增强可以写在invoke中。上代码 package com.mmh.springbootall.test; /** * @Description: 阅读全文
posted @ 2020-06-23 18:35 哈皮的玩偶 阅读(171) 评论(0) 推荐(0) 编辑

处理postman传参中文乱码问题

摘要: private Map<String, Object> getParam(HttpServletRequest request){ Map<String, String[]> map = request.getParameterMap(); Map<String, Object> requestMa 阅读全文
posted @ 2020-06-05 17:43 哈皮的玩偶 阅读(1779) 评论(0) 推荐(0) 编辑

如何使用RedisTemplate访问Redis数据结构

摘要: 以下文章转载自:https://www.jianshu.com/p/7bf5dc61ca06 Redis 数据结构简介 Redis 可以存储键与5种不同数据结构类型之间的映射,这5种数据结构类型分别为String(字符串)、List(列表)、Set(集合)、Hash(散列)和 Zset(有序集合)。 阅读全文
posted @ 2020-05-21 10:11 哈皮的玩偶 阅读(400) 评论(0) 推荐(0) 编辑

redis 简单限流

摘要: /** * @Description: 简单限流 * @Author : myron * @Date : 2020-05-09 17:43 **/ public class SimpleLimiter { private Jedis jedis; public SimpleLimiter(Jedis 阅读全文
posted @ 2020-05-09 17:48 哈皮的玩偶 阅读(187) 评论(0) 推荐(0) 编辑

Caused by: org.apache.ibatis.binding.BindingException: Parameter '__frch_item_0' not found. Available parameters are [list]

摘要: Caused by: org.apache.ibatis.binding.BindingException: Parameter '__frch_item_0' not found. Available parameters are [list] 解决办法: 1.其实这里的批量保存 ,mybatis 阅读全文
posted @ 2020-04-21 15:52 哈皮的玩偶 阅读(1062) 评论(0) 推荐(0) 编辑

简单的根据权重随机数负载均衡算法

摘要: package datastructure.loadbalance; import java.util.ArrayList; import java.util.List; import java.util.Random; /** * <h3>netty_lecture</h3> * <p>权重路由简 阅读全文
posted @ 2020-03-20 17:46 哈皮的玩偶 阅读(433) 评论(0) 推荐(0) 编辑

后缀表达式(逆波兰表达式)计算器

摘要: package datastructure.stack; import java.util.*; /** * <h3>netty_lecture</h3> * <p>逆波兰计算器</p> * 1+((2+3)*4)-5 ==> 1 2 3 + 4 * + 5 1 * @author : myron 阅读全文
posted @ 2020-03-19 21:11 哈皮的玩偶 阅读(1402) 评论(0) 推荐(0) 编辑

进程和线程的区别

摘要: 进程:一个程序实例。举例,PC端:比如打开一个浏览器,开了一个进程;打开记事本,开了一个进程;手机端:打开微信,开一个进程;打开QQ,又开一个进程; 每个进程,都至少会占用到CPU的资源 线程:程序实例中的调度CPU分配资源的单位。比如微信发信息,是一个线程;发语音是一个进程;各种交互 ,各种线程 阅读全文
posted @ 2019-10-23 11:10 哈皮的玩偶 阅读(132) 评论(0) 推荐(0) 编辑

spring源码分析

摘要: 一、xml中bean的解析 1,加载配置文件 BeanFactory bf = new XmlBeanFactory(new ClassPathResource("abc.xml")); ClassPathResource中将xml文件封装为Resource类型;然后调用XmlBeanFactory 阅读全文
posted @ 2019-10-23 09:52 哈皮的玩偶 阅读(161) 评论(0) 推荐(0) 编辑